Swenglish is fine. Translating everything into Swedish is just insane. But Swenglish, especially with gaming in mind, is actually pretty defined.
"Game ett har börjat." (Game one has started) - This is fine. They (sort of) do the same in tennis.
"Gamet har börjat" (The game has started) - This is ok. A bit too Swenglish to blame it on gaming though.
"Gamet har begint" (The game has startedt)" - No. Just no. Go away.
